Suburb snapshot

Broadmeadows (Vic.) is a mid-sized suburb in the Hume area, home to around 12,524 residents (2021 Census). Available data shows 3,869 offences in 2026 with rising year-on-year trends (+8%), roughly 308.9 offences per 1,000 residents, 9 school and preschool sites in the area, strong public transport coverage with many Public Transport Victoria stops, many local shops, services and recreation venues, 6 active roadworks or transport incidents on nearby routes, and notable planning and development activity on record. Snapshot data also shows parks or public open space within the suburb and hospitals or GP clinics within the suburb.
